hm11,

Thanks a lot. Hope you get yours fast.
Mine was delayed becasue the officer told me that there is another file with my name and he nedded to check that. You know how it goes now with all these security checks.
He told me if I didn't hear anything from him in 6 months I would send him an inquiry. I didn't need to send him one as my oath was sent to me in 5 and half months. My total time was 6 months exactly from the interview.
Hope this helps, don't worry.
